To manually integrate a Twitter List onto your website, you can follow these steps:
- Open your Twitter account.
- Copy your List URL in the web browser.
- Go to https://publish.twitter.com/#
- Paste the URL of your Twitter List. For example https://twitter.com/i/lists/1463621736923111435
- Click "Copy Code" to get the HTML code.
- Paste this code into your website or blog.
- Publish and done!
While the manual approach has its limitations—such as the inability of the feed to self-update if modified or deleted, a lack of interactive features similar to those on Twitter, and the necessity for manual updates for any changes— it may not be the best option for those requiring frequent alterations.

Add Twitter List widget to your Squarespace website
The second part is adding your Twitter List widget to your Squarespace website. After you customize your Twitter List widget and copied the embed code, it is time to add it to your Squarespace website. Follow the steps below.
- Copy your free Twitter List widget embed code. Make sure you followed the first part above. It detailed how to you can create and customize your widget to get your free embed code.
- Login to Squarespace. You must have a "Business" account in Squarespace to use the widget. The "code block" needed cannot be found if you only have a "Personal" account.
- Create a new blank page or edit your existing page. Identify which page you want the widget to appear. You can create a new page on Squarespace, or you can edit your existing page where you want the widget to appear.
- Add a Code Block. On your Squarespace page, click the 'Edit' button. Find the 'Code' block and click it.
- Paste the embed code from SociableKIT. On the 'Content' of the 'Code' block, paste the JavaScript embed code you have copied from your widget.
- Save the changes on the 'Code block'. After pasting your widget's embed code. Click the 'Save' button on the left part of the page.
- View your page. Refresh your Squarespace page and check your SociableKIT widget. Done!
